  Northern Ireland Social Attitudes Survey - 1990

Year: 1990

Module: Morality
Variable: SEXLAW


Question:
There is a law in the UK against sex discrimination, that is against giving unfair preference to men - or to women - in employment, pay and so on. Do you generally support or oppose the idea of a law for this purpose?

Overall Results %
Support87
Oppose11
Don't know2
Not answered1


Results for men and women
%
 MaleFemale
Support 86 87
Oppose 12 10
Don't know 1 2
Not answered 1 1

Results for people of different ages
%
 18-2425-3435-4445-5455-6465+
Support 92 89 94 82 86 80
Oppose 8 11 5 14 11 15
Don't know 0 1 1 3 3 3
Not answered 0 0 1 2 1 3

Results for people of different religions
%
 CatholicProtestantNo religion
Support 89 84 92
Oppose 9 13 8
Don't know 1 2 0
Not answered 1 1 0
